Coach Steve starts this episode with a deep reflection from his amazing FIVE-DAY Wilderness Experience in Yosemite. The idea is to capture how nature symbolizes something in our personal and professional life that we are also embarking on. Today, we're going to unpack what that looks with this episode on "TRAILS".

Trails symbolize the twists and turns in life. It's the walk in pursuit of something greater - seeking more knowledge, self-discovery, or new experiences!

LISTEN FOR THESE MOMENTS:

"No matter how much time I spend studying various trails - and researching people's comments on the routes - it was still impossible to fully prepare for the trail we had picked (in Yosemite). I had an idea of what the trail might look like and what we might experience in that - but it was impossible to fully prepare for the unknown twists and turns. I had not been there yet, how could I?".
